Professional Documents
Culture Documents
n
n
n
Tramo 1:
Tramo 2:
Tramo 3:
Tramo 4:
Tramo 5:
Mdulos
Actividades de un Mdulo
Tarea 0: Descargar transparencias y ejemplos del mdulo
n
Herramientas a utilizar
Simulador/Editor interactivo
n
Sublime Text 2
n
https://developer.chrome.com/devtools
https://www.mozilla.org/es-ES/firefox/new/
Juan Quemada, DIT, UPM
Simulador en ViSH
Seleccionar
mdulo
Guardar modificaciones en
memoria local del navegador
Descargar ejemplo
con modificaciones
a un fichero
Seleccionar
tema
Visualizar
modificaciones
Seleccionar
ejemplo
Area de
visualizacin
de la
aplicacin
Area de
edicin del
cdigo
fuente de
los
ejemplo
http://vishub.org/excursions/2209.full
Juan Quemada, DIT, UPM
10
11
Servidores:
n
12
Clientes, navegadores
y tiendas
Clientes de acceso a Internet ms importantes
n
Tiendas de aplicaciones
n
13
192.9.0.144,
...
2001:db8:85a3::8a2e:370:7334, ....
14
Servidor (host)
puerto 25
Servidores y puertos
direccin
IP
puerto 80
Web:
HTTP
Puerto
n
email:
SMTP
Web:
protocolo HTTP (puerto 80), HTTPS (443)
Email:
protocolo SMTP (puerto 25), POP3 (110), IMAP143)
Shell segura: protocolo SSH (puerto 22)
15
google.com
URL
http://google.com/picture.png
16
GET:
trae al cliente (lee) un recurso identificado por un URL
POST: crea un recurso identificado por un URL
PUT:
actualiza un recurso identificado por un URL
DELETE: borra un recurso identificado `pr un URL
....... (hay mas comandos)
upm.es
google.com
HTTP GET
apple.es
Juan Quemada, DIT, UPM
17
Aplicacin Web
Aplicaciones ejecutables en un navegador creadas con
n
HTML
n
CSS
n
JavaScript
n
18
Lenguaje de marcado
CSS
n
Estilo la visualizacin
JavaScript
n
Lenguaje de programacin
19
Respuesta HTTP:
pgina Web con script
20
21